A motor bike robber was on Wednesday nabbed by security guards in the New Kingston area after he turned up at a gas station trying to collect ransom money.

Some 36 bank cards and six cell phones were found in his possession.

"I will have my forensic examiners go through it," Assistant Commissioner of Police Chambers Clifford Chambers, who heads the Counter Terrorism and Organised Investigation Branch, said.

The arrest of the bike robber follows the robbery of an employee of a popular security company. The robber took the woman's bank card and her cell phone.

"We called the phone and tell him that we a go give you a money if you give we the phone and the card," one of the men involved in the operation said.

After some negotiations, both parties agreed to meet at a gas station on Oxford Road. "We were in a plain car, we nuh have no marked vehicle parked up at the gas station, and as him ride in and was about to call the girl, we fly out and hold him."
